Why isn’t my lawn mower starting after the winter?

Byadmin May 30, 2022

The battery is worn out. Lawn mower batteries can be expected to last about five years. If the battery isn’t staying charged long enough or if it’s completely dead, try using a battery charger. What would cause a lawn mower not to start?

Byadmin May 30, 2022

Your Mower Won’t Start: If you have last season’s gas in your mower, drain your fuel tank and fill with fresh gas. Other possible causes include: Loose, Dirty or Disconnected Spark Plug in Your Lawn Mower: Check it out, clean off debris, re-connect and tighten. Dirty Air Filter: Clean or replace. Rotary lawnmowers have a single blade that rotates horizontally underneath the mower, like the propellers of a plane. Rotary lawn mowers are the most versatile type and will cope with most types of grass. They are better than cylinder mowers at cutting longer and rougher grass.
